PHP Fatal error

This topic contains 16 replies, has 3 voices, and was last updated by  akia 6 years, 6 months ago.

We have moved to a support ticketing system and our forums are now closed.

Open Support Ticket
  • Author
    Posts
  • #402270

    akia
    Buyer
    Post count: 35

    Same problem as here: https://wpgeodirectory.com/support/topic/fatal-error-under-php-7-1-10/

    When adding or editing payments I get the following errors.

    
    
    2017/10/23 19:52:03 [error] 678#678: *7178 FastCGI sent in stderr: "PHP message: PHP Fatal error:  Uncaught Error: [] operator not supported for strings in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php:2666
    Stack trace:
    #0 /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php(2067): geodir_add_edit_price()
    #1 /var/www/theuk/wp-includes/class-wp-hook.php(298): geodir_payment_manager_ajax('')
    #2 /var/www/theuk/wp-includes/class-wp-hook.php(323): WP_Hook->apply_filters('', Array)
    #3 /var/www/theuk/wp-includes/plugin.php(453): WP_Hook->do_action(Array)
    #4 /var/www/theuk/wp-admin/admin-ajax.php(91): do_action('wp_ajax_geodir_...')
    #5 {main}
      thrown in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php on line 2666" while reading response header from upstream, client: 77.96.148.222, server: theuk.directory, request: "POST /wp-admin/admin-ajax.php?action=geodir_payment_manager_ajax H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/admin.php?page=geodirectory&tab=paymentmanager_fields&subtab=geodir_payment_manager&gd_pagetype=addeditprice"
    2017/10/23 19:52:36 [error] 678#678: *7178 FastCGI sent in stderr: "PHP message: PHP Fatal error:  Uncaught Error: [] operator not supported for strings in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php:2666
    Stack trace:
    #0 /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php(2067): geodir_add_edit_price()
    #1 /var/www/theuk/wp-includes/class-wp-hook.php(298): geodir_payment_manager_ajax('')
    #2 /var/www/theuk/wp-includes/class-wp-hook.php(323): WP_Hook->apply_filters('', Array)
    #3 /var/www/theuk/wp-includes/plugin.php(453): WP_Hook->do_action(Array)
    #4 /var/www/theuk/wp-admin/admin-ajax.php(91): do_action('wp_ajax_geodir_...')
    #5 {main}
      thrown in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php on line 2666" while reading response header from upstream, client: 77.96.148.222, server: theuk.directory, request: "POST /wp-admin/admin-ajax.php?action=geodir_payment_manager_ajax H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/admin.php?page=geodirectory&tab=paymentmanager_fields&subtab=geodir_payment_manager&gd_pagetype=addeditprice"
    2017/10/23 19:52:45 [error] 678#678: *7178 FastCGI sent in stderr: "PHP message: PHP Fatal error:  Uncaught Error: [] operator not supported for strings in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php:2666
    Stack trace:
    #0 /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php(2067): geodir_add_edit_price()
    #1 /var/www/theuk/wp-includes/class-wp-hook.php(298): geodir_payment_manager_ajax('')
    #2 /var/www/theuk/wp-includes/class-wp-hook.php(323): WP_Hook->apply_filters('', Array)
    #3 /var/www/theuk/wp-includes/plugin.php(453): WP_Hook->do_action(Array)
    #4 /var/www/theuk/wp-admin/admin-ajax.php(91): do_action('wp_ajax_geodir_...')
    #5 {main}
      thrown in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php on line 2666" while reading response header from upstream, client: 77.96.148.222, server: theuk.directory, request: "POST /wp-admin/admin-ajax.php?action=geodir_payment_manager_ajax H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/admin.php?page=geodirectory&tab=paymentmanager_fields&subtab=geodir_payment_manager&gd_pagetype=addeditprice"
    2017/10/23 19:52:53 [error] 678#678: *7178 FastCGI sent in stderr: "PHP message: PHP Fatal error:  Uncaught Error: [] operator not supported for strings in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php:2666
    Stack trace:
    #0 /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php(2067): geodir_add_edit_price()
    #1 /var/www/theuk/wp-includes/class-wp-hook.php(298): geodir_payment_manager_ajax('')
    #2 /var/www/theuk/wp-includes/class-wp-hook.php(323): WP_Hook->apply_filters('', Array)
    #3 /var/www/theuk/wp-includes/plugin.php(453): WP_Hook->do_action(Array)
    #4 /var/www/theuk/wp-admin/admin-ajax.php(91): do_action('wp_ajax_geodir_...')
    #5 {main}
      thrown in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php on line 2666" while reading response header from upstream, client: 77.96.148.222, server: theuk.directory, request: "POST /wp-admin/admin-ajax.php?action=geodir_payment_manager_ajax H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/admin.php?page=geodirectory&tab=paymentmanager_fields&subtab=geodir_payment_manager&gd_pagetype=addeditprice"
    2017/10/23 19:59:24 [error] 678#678: *7274 FastCGI sent in stderr: "PHP message: PHP Fatal error:  Uncaught Error: [] operator not supported for strings in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php:2666
    Stack trace:
    #0 /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php(2067): geodir_add_edit_price()
    #1 /var/www/theuk/wp-includes/class-wp-hook.php(298): geodir_payment_manager_ajax('')
    #2 /var/www/theuk/wp-includes/class-wp-hook.php(323): WP_Hook->apply_filters('', Array)
    #3 /var/www/theuk/wp-includes/plugin.php(453): WP_Hook->do_action(Array)
    #4 /var/www/theuk/wp-admin/admin-ajax.php(91): do_action('wp_ajax_geodir_...')
    #5 {main}
      thrown in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php on line 2666" while reading response header from upstream, client: 77.96.148.222, server: theuk.directory, request: "POST /wp-admin/admin-ajax.php?action=geodir_payment_manager_ajax H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/admin.php?page=geodirectory&tab=paymentmanager_fields&subtab=geodir_payment_manager&gd_pagetype=addeditprice&id=5"
    2017/10/23 19:59:38 [error] 678#678: *7274 FastCGI sent in stderr: "PHP message: PHP Fatal error:  Uncaught Error: [] operator not supported for strings in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php:2666
    Stack trace:
    #0 /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php(2067): geodir_add_edit_price()
    #1 /var/www/theuk/wp-includes/class-wp-hook.php(298): geodir_payment_manager_ajax('')
    #2 /var/www/theuk/wp-includes/class-wp-hook.php(323): WP_Hook->apply_filters('', Array)
    #3 /var/www/theuk/wp-includes/plugin.php(453): WP_Hook->do_action(Array)
    #4 /var/www/theuk/wp-admin/admin-ajax.php(91): do_action('wp_ajax_geodir_...')
    #5 {main}
      thrown in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php on line 2666" while reading response header from upstream, client: 77.96.148.222, server: theuk.directory, request: "POST /wp-admin/admin-ajax.php?action=geodir_payment_manager_ajax H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/admin.php?page=geodirectory&tab=paymentmanager_fields&subtab=geodir_payment_manager&gd_pagetype=addeditprice&id=6"
    2017/10/23 19:59:56 [error] 678#678: *7274 FastCGI sent in stderr: "PHP message: PHP Fatal error:  Uncaught Error: [] operator not supported for strings in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php:2666
    Stack trace:
    #0 /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php(2067): geodir_add_edit_price()
    #1 /var/www/theuk/wp-includes/class-wp-hook.php(298): geodir_payment_manager_ajax('')
    #2 /var/www/theuk/wp-includes/class-wp-hook.php(323): WP_Hook->apply_filters('', Array)
    #3 /var/www/theuk/wp-includes/plugin.php(453): WP_Hook->do_action(Array)
    #4 /var/www/theuk/wp-admin/admin-ajax.php(91): do_action('wp_ajax_geodir_...')
    #5 {main}
      thrown in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php on line 2666" while reading response header from upstream, client: 77.96.148.222, server: theuk.directory, request: "POST /wp-admin/admin-ajax.php?action=geodir_payment_manager_ajax H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/admin.php?page=geodirectory&tab=paymentmanager_fields&subtab=geodir_payment_manager&gd_pagetype=addeditprice&id=7"
    2017/10/23 20:00:24 [error] 678#678: *7274 FastCGI sent in stderr: "PHP message: PHP Fatal error:  Uncaught Error: [] operator not supported for strings in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php:2666
    Stack trace:
    #0 /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php(2067): geodir_add_edit_price()
    #1 /var/www/theuk/wp-includes/class-wp-hook.php(298): geodir_payment_manager_ajax('')
    #2 /var/www/theuk/wp-includes/class-wp-hook.php(323): WP_Hook->apply_filters('', Array)
    #3 /var/www/theuk/wp-includes/plugin.php(453): WP_Hook->do_action(Array)
    #4 /var/www/theuk/wp-admin/admin-ajax.php(91): do_action('wp_ajax_geodir_...')
    #5 {main}
      thrown in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php on line 2666" while reading response header from upstream, client: 77.96.148.222, server: theuk.directory, request: "POST /wp-admin/admin-ajax.php?action=geodir_payment_manager_ajax H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/admin.php?page=geodirectory&tab=paymentmanager_fields&subtab=geodir_payment_manager&gd_pagetype=addeditprice&id=5"
    2017/10/23 20:00:35 [error] 678#678: *7274 FastCGI sent in stderr: "PHP message: PHP Fatal error:  Uncaught Error: [] operator not supported for strings in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php:2666
    Stack trace:
    #0 /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php(2067): geodir_add_edit_price()
    #1 /var/www/theuk/wp-includes/class-wp-hook.php(298): geodir_payment_manager_ajax('')
    #2 /var/www/theuk/wp-includes/class-wp-hook.php(323): WP_Hook->apply_filters('', Array)
    #3 /var/www/theuk/wp-includes/plugin.php(453): WP_Hook->do_action(Array)
    #4 /var/www/theuk/wp-admin/admin-ajax.php(91): do_action('wp_ajax_geodir_...')
    #5 {main}
      thrown in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php on line 2666" while reading response header from upstream, client: 77.96.148.222, server: theuk.directory, request: "POST /wp-admin/admin-ajax.php?action=geodir_payment_manager_ajax H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/admin.php?page=geodirectory&tab=paymentmanager_fields&subtab=geodir_payment_manager&gd_pagetype=addeditprice&id=6"
    2017/10/23 20:01:29 [error] 678#678: *7274 FastCGI sent in stderr: "PHP message: PHP Fatal error:  Uncaught Error: [] operator not supported for strings in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php:2666
    Stack trace:
    #0 /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php(2067): geodir_add_edit_price()
    #1 /var/www/theuk/wp-includes/class-wp-hook.php(298): geodir_payment_manager_ajax('')
    #2 /var/www/theuk/wp-includes/class-wp-hook.php(323): WP_Hook->apply_filters('', Array)
    #3 /var/www/theuk/wp-includes/plugin.php(453): WP_Hook->do_action(Array)
    #4 /var/www/theuk/wp-admin/admin-ajax.php(91): do_action('wp_ajax_geodir_...')
    #5 {main}
      thrown in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php on line 2666" while reading response header from upstream, client: 77.96.148.222, server: theuk.directory, request: "POST /wp-admin/admin-ajax.php?action=geodir_payment_manager_ajax H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/admin.php?page=geodirectory&tab=paymentmanager_fields&subtab=geodir_payment_manager&gd_pagetype=addeditprice&id=4"
    2017/10/23 20:03:40 [error] 678#678: *7397 FastCGI sent in stderr: "PHP message: PHP Warning:  Cannot assign an empty string to a string offset in /var/www/theuk/wp-includes/class.wp-scripts.php on line 447" while reading upstream, client: 77.96.148.222, server: theuk.directory, request: "GET /wp-admin/post-new.php?post_type=wpi_discount H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/edit.php?post_type=wpi_discount"
    2017/10/23 20:37:12 [error] 678#678: *7592 FastCGI sent in stderr: "PHP message: PHP Fatal error:  Uncaught Error: [] operator not supported for strings in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php:2666
    Stack trace:
    #0 /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php(2067): geodir_add_edit_price()
    #1 /var/www/theuk/wp-includes/class-wp-hook.php(298): geodir_payment_manager_ajax('')
    #2 /var/www/theuk/wp-includes/class-wp-hook.php(323): WP_Hook->apply_filters('', Array)
    #3 /var/www/theuk/wp-includes/plugin.php(453): WP_Hook->do_action(Array)
    #4 /var/www/theuk/wp-admin/admin-ajax.php(91): do_action('wp_ajax_geodir_...')
    #5 {main}
      thrown in /var/www/theuk/wp-content/plugins/geodir_payment_manager/geodir_payment_functions.php on line 2666" while reading response header from upstream, client: 77.96.148.222, server: theuk.directory, request: "POST /wp-admin/admin-ajax.php?action=geodir_payment_manager_ajax HTTP/1.1", upstream: "fastcgi://unix:/run/php/php7.1-fpm.sock:", host: "theuk.directory", referrer: "https://theuk.directory/wp-admin/admin.php?page=geodirectory&tab=paymentmanager_fields&subtab=geodir_payment_manager&gd_pagetype=addeditprice"
    #402272

    akia
    Buyer
    Post count: 35
    This reply has been marked as private.
    #402298

    Stiofan O’Connor
    Site Admin
    Post count: 22956

    A valid license is required to view this reply.

    You may need to login

    OR

    Buy either a Membership or valid license for this product.

    Thanks, Team GeoDirectory!

    #402319

    akia
    Buyer
    Post count: 35
    This reply has been marked as private.
    #402336

    Stiofan O’Connor
    Site Admin
    Post count: 22956

    A valid license is required to view this reply.

    You may need to login

    OR

    Buy either a Membership or valid license for this product.

    Thanks, Team GeoDirectory!

    #402337

    akia
    Buyer
    Post count: 35
    This reply has been marked as private.
    #402341

    Stiofan O’Connor
    Site Admin
    Post count: 22956

    A valid license is required to view this reply.

    You may need to login

    OR

    Buy either a Membership or valid license for this product.

    Thanks, Team GeoDirectory!

    #402342

    akia
    Buyer
    Post count: 35

    A valid license is required to view this reply.

    You may need to login

    OR

    Buy either a Membership or valid license for this product.

    Thanks, Team GeoDirectory!

    #402344

    akia
    Buyer
    Post count: 35

    A valid license is required to view this reply.

    You may need to login

    OR

    Buy either a Membership or valid license for this product.

    Thanks, Team GeoDirectory!

    #402346

    akia
    Buyer
    Post count: 35
    This reply has been marked as private.
    #402360

    Stiofan O’Connor
    Site Admin
    Post count: 22956

    A valid license is required to view this reply.

    You may need to login

    OR

    Buy either a Membership or valid license for this product.

    Thanks, Team GeoDirectory!

    #402361

    akia
    Buyer
    Post count: 35
    This reply has been marked as private.
    #402362

    akia
    Buyer
    Post count: 35
    This reply has been marked as private.
    #402488

    Kiran
    Moderator
    Post count: 7069

    A valid license is required to view this reply.

    You may need to login

    OR

    Buy either a Membership or valid license for this product.

    Thanks, Team GeoDirectory!

    #402491

    akia
    Buyer
    Post count: 35
    This reply has been marked as private.
Viewing 15 posts - 1 through 15 (of 17 total)

We have moved to a support ticketing system and our forums are now closed.

Open Support Ticket